    Nothing Easy | Thunder & Spurs Going To Game 7

    The Thunder dropped Game 6 in San Antonio, 118-91, and it wasn't close after the Spurs went on a 22-0 run in the third to blow the doors off the game. Now, we're going to Game 7. Bobby and Jamison break down what went wrong: Shai held to 15 points on 6-for-18 shooting, the Spurs' perimeter defense absolutely smothering him in the midrange, a lack of role player performance, and JDub's unfortunate performance in his return to play.     Built for This | Thunder Lead Spurs 3-2

    The Thunder took Game 5 at home without Jalen Williams, with Shai committing six turnovers and missing his first four shots... and still won by 13. OKC leads the Spurs 3-2 and is one win away from the NBA Finals. Bobby and Jamison break down what actually flipped from Game 4 to Game 5: Chet Holmgren's best game of the series, Jared McCain's 20-point playoff starting debut, Isaiah Hartenstein holding Victor Wembanyama to 4-of-15, and Alex Caruso doing what he always does when it matters most. They also get into Stephon Castle's post-game officiating complaints and what they reveal about a young Spurs team still finding its footing.The Thunder are certainly built for this.     Thunder Stomp Suns in Game 1

    OKC ran Phoenix out of the building in Game 1 in a 119-84 romp. Bobby breaks down the defensive swarm that caused 17 turnovers and forced 13 steals, Dillon Brooks' hijinks, Chet and JDub's big day, and the importance of Game 2.
